Author:Klotz, A.
Title:Norms reconstituting interests: global racial equality and U.S. sanctions against South Africa
Journal:International Organization
1995 : SUMMER, VOL. 49:3, p. 451-478
Index terms:USA
SOUTH AFRICA
INTERNATIONAL
Language:eng
Abstract:The extraordinary success of transnational anti-apartheid activists in generating great power sanctions against South Africa offers ample evidence that norms, independent of strategic and economic considerations, are an important factor in determining states' policies. The crucial role of a strengthened global norm of racial equality in motivating U.S. anti-apartheid sanctions illustrates the limitations of conventional international relations theories.
